According to Don News, according to police officer Syed Ali Nasir, Sana Yusuf was shot from the front by a 22 -year -old man. The police claim that this poor man shot him after the ticket of ‘Friendship’ was repeatedly denied by Ticketocker Sana Yusuf.
Pakistani sewers have been caused by this incident of murder in the residential area of Islamabad, the capital of Pakistan. On this murder, there is a debate on the rights of women, their freedom to work in Pakistani society.
The 17 -year -old bubbly girl was a local star in her sense. He had 8 lakh followers on the ticket and was following 5 lakh people on Instagram.
IG Rizvi said that this boy had tried to contact Sana again and again and “he rejected him again and again”.
According to the Pakistani police, the culprit wanted to establish contact with social media influenus Sana and “friendship” with him.
IG Rizvi said that the person had “tried his best to contact Sana’s birthday on 29 May. “He reached her house and tried to meet her for seven to eight hours, but failed.”
According to IG Police Syed Ali Nasir Rizvi, this 22 -year -old eccentric tried for 8 hours to meet Sana for one day. But he could not succeed.
According to the police, Sana refused to meet the boy on the phone first. After this he went to meet himself. But this time too it was rejected.

Earlier, Home Minister Mohsin Naqvi confirmed the arrest of this murderer in a post on X, the Home Minister said, “The incident happened in Islamabad yesterday, when a masked accused killed a young woman.”
He further said that the suspect was arrested at around 12 noon. Naqvi said that the police have recovered the weapon and pistol used in the murder, as well as the mobile phone used by the deceased woman. He said that the suspect has confessed to the murder.
In the FIR of this murder, the Ticketocker’s mother said that at around 5 pm, a person suddenly entered his house with a pistol in his hand and “shot directly with the intention of killing my daughter.”
He further said that two bullets were hit in Sana’s chest, causing her seriously injured. The FIR states that the girl was rushed to the hospital, but she succumbed.
The girl’s mother told that the killer was “smart looking, medium height saddle” and she was wearing a black shirt and pants. She claimed that she and her sister -in -law Latifa Shah were an eyewitness to the incident and if she personally looks at her, she could identify the suspect.
Tickets are banned in India
Let us know that tickets in India were banned due to security and privacy concerns in 2020, while this app is still going on in Pakistan. According to some sources, by 2023, there were about 2.52 crore (25.2 million) active users of tickets in Pakistan.
This number is increasing rapidly, because the youth population in Pakistan is getting attracted in large numbers towards social media platforms. The reason for the popularity of the ticket is to get a big platform for the younger generation trend, entertainment, and social issues opinion there.
